How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Uptown Pittsburgh?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Uptown Pittsburgh Studio Apartments | $1,551 | $1,005 | $2,675 |
| Uptown Pittsburgh 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,923 | $950 | $3,831 |
| Uptown Pittsburgh 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,550 | $1,335 | $6,500 |
| Uptown Pittsburgh 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,156 | $1,125 | $5,997 |
| Uptown Pittsburgh 4 Bedroom Apartments | $1,350 | $1,350 | $1,350 |

Getting Around the Uptown Pittsburgh Neighborhood in Pittsburgh, PA
Walk Score®
81 / 100
Very Walkable
Most errands can be accomplished on foot
Bike Score®
67 / 100
Bikeable
Some bike infrastructure
Transit Score®
82 / 100
Excellent Transit
Transit is convenient for most trips
What Are Walk Score®, Transit Score®, and Bike Score® Ratings?
- Walk Score® measures the walkability of any address.
- Transit Score® measures access to public transit.
- Bike Score® measures the bikeability of any address.
